AI: The Brains Behind the Mobile Productivity Boost
The integration of AI isn’t just about adding gimmicks. It’s fundamentally changing how we interact with tablets and accomplish tasks. Features like handwriting recognition, now remarkably accurate thanks to AI algorithms, are transforming note-taking and document annotation. Smart multitasking, intelligently allocating resources to running apps, ensures a smooth experience even with multiple programs open. Consider the Samsung Galaxy Tab S11 series, which leverages AI to optimize performance based on usage patterns, extending battery life and enhancing responsiveness. This isn’t just about speed; it’s about a more intuitive and efficient user experience.
Beyond the premium segment, even entry-level tablets like the itel VistaTab 11 are incorporating AI features. The inclusion of tools like automatic photo correction for school assignments and instant translation demonstrates that AI-powered productivity isn’t limited to high-end devices. This democratization of AI is crucial for expanding access to these benefits.
The Cellular Advantage: Untethered Productivity
The inclusion of a SIM card slot is the key to unlocking the full potential of these AI-powered tablets. It provides a constant, reliable internet connection, eliminating the reliance on often-unstable public Wi-Fi networks. This is particularly vital for professionals in fields like field service, logistics, and sales, who frequently work remotely. A recent study by Statista showed a 25% increase in mobile worker productivity when consistently connected to a reliable network. For students, it means seamless access to online learning resources, research materials, and collaborative tools, regardless of location.
Pro Tip: When choosing a tablet with cellular connectivity, consider the network bands supported by your carrier to ensure optimal performance in your region.
Future Trends: What’s on the Horizon?
The current trajectory suggests several exciting developments in the coming years:
- Enhanced AI Personalization: Expect AI to become even more personalized, learning individual user habits and proactively suggesting actions or automating tasks. Imagine a tablet that automatically prepares a presentation based on your upcoming meetings or filters out irrelevant notifications.
- Advanced Natural Language Processing (NLP): Improved NLP will enable more sophisticated voice control and text-based interactions, making tablets even easier to use hands-free.
- Edge AI Processing: Moving AI processing from the cloud to the device itself (edge AI) will enhance privacy, reduce latency, and enable functionality even without an internet connection.
- Foldable Tablet Innovation: The emergence of foldable tablets, like the Samsung Galaxy Z Fold series, will offer a larger screen real estate for enhanced productivity while maintaining portability.
- AR/VR Integration: Tablets will increasingly serve as a gateway to augmented and virtual reality experiences, opening up new possibilities for training, design, and entertainment.

The Impact on Specific Industries
Several industries are poised to benefit significantly from this trend:
- Education: AI-powered tablets can personalize learning experiences, provide instant feedback, and facilitate remote learning.
- Healthcare: Mobile tablets enable doctors and nurses to access patient records, conduct virtual consultations, and administer care remotely.
- Retail: Sales associates can use tablets to access product information, process transactions, and provide personalized customer service.
- Construction: Tablets can be used for on-site project management, blueprint viewing, and data collection.
